Electric Treadmill Vs Manual Treadmill

Treadmills are a staple of fitness. If you're training like Usain Bolt or trying to complete some miles an electric Small treadmill treadmill can aid you in reaching your goals.

However, there are some particular advantages to a manual treadmill, which include cost-effectiveness as well as environmentally friendly operation. Find out more about the pros, cons, and features of each treadmill.

Cost

This is because they require a motor which can be costly. This type of treadmill has more features that can make your workout more engaging and enjoyable. For instance, some electric treadmills offer incline settings, which can simulate different terrains. A lot of treadmills with electric motors have speakers and screens included so you can use them to watch Netflix while exercising!

Manual treadmills are more affordable than their electric counterparts and are an excellent option for those with small spaces in their apartments or homes. However, they don't offer the same range of features that electric treadmills do, including incline adjustments and automated speed changes in pre-made workouts.

They can also be difficult for runners to use when they need a smooth experience. They are also not as durable as other types of exercise equipment. They can also be loud and strain joints particularly if you suffer from arthritis or other medical conditions.

Besides being inexpensive They are also lightweight and easy to store. It is possible to store a manual treadmill wherever, even outside, unlike an electric treadmill that requires an electrical outlet. Convenience

A treadmill can be a great piece of equipment to keep active at home or at the gym. There are two kinds of treadmills - manual and electric. Both have pros and cons However, the type you pick will depend on your fitness goals and budget.

Electric treadmills are more expensive than their manual counterparts, but they offer a variety of extra features. They can offer a variety of exercises that you can personalize, and they permit you to alter your intensity and speed. They also have a more comfortable surface for running that can reduce the strain on joints. They are more noisy than manual treadmills and require more maintenance.

Manual treadmills are a less expensive alternative to electric models. However, they come with limited functionality. A majority of them are constructed with a flat belt, and do not include extra features such as heart rate monitors or incline control. However, some have simple display systems powered by batteries that show the distance covered, the time elapsed and calories burned. They may be a good option for those looking to exercise at home and do not have a lot of money to spend.

Both kinds of treadmills can be effective in losing weight, however electric treadmills can be more practical for those who wish to monitor their progress. They also have a more precise speed display and can automatically adjust the speed based on your current heart rate. They can also help you save time by allowing you adjust the settings without having to spend it manually.

While treadmills can offer a good workout, they can also put a lot of stress on your knees and ankles. Manual treadmills, particularly ones with belts that are flat, can have more impact due to the fact that you must apply force to move the belt. This can cause discomfort and be hard on the joints, especially if you already have problems.

Safety

Manual treadmills do not need to be connected to a power source, and are therefore more portable than electric treadmills. However, this comes with a few disadvantages. First, the user must generate enough force to move the belt, which may cause joint stress and injury. In addition, the users need to keep their weight in check and also the belt's movement which makes it difficult to maintain an even running pace. Most manual treadmills that are flat are not cushioned and create additional strain on joints.

The majority of treadmills that are electric, on the other hand come with a motor that moves your belt. This enables a range of speed settings, and can accommodate runners of different fitness levels. Additionally, some models have adjustable incline settings that can simulate various terrains. Maintenance

Manual treadmills do not have an engine built into them to run the belt. They depend on the energy of the runner to power the belt, so that they can control their own speed. This can improve your running performance and allow for greater flexibility. It also reduces the amount stress on the body. It can be beneficial for runners who are trying to recover from injuries and increase their endurance.

Additionally manual treadmills are also less expensive than electric treadmills and require fewer maintenance costs. They tend to be less complicated in design and have fewer parts to break over time. They are also lightweight and ideal for those looking to exercise at home or in a gym with limited space. However, a disadvantage of these treadmills is that they are generally noisy and may cause disruption to your exercise.

An electric treadmill has an inbuilt motor to drive the belt, which is much easier to walk or run on than a manual treadmill. It comes with a wide range of speeds and incline levels making it suitable for those who wish to do a longer workout like running or training for a marathon. However, this type treadmill requires electricity to function and you'll need a power source close by. It also generates quite a lot of noise which can be distracting when you're working out in a communal space or with other people.

The main disadvantage of an electric treadmill is that it's more expensive than manual treadmills. It is also heavier and has a larger footprint, which might not be suited to small electric treadmill for apartment spaces. In addition the motor of an electric treadmill could cause problems if it is overheated or becomes noisy.

The final decision between a manual and an electric treadmill is dependent on your preferences and fitness goals. A manual treadmill is simple to use and is less expensive, while motorized treadmills offer automated features that provide a more dynamic workout. Before you choose a treadmill consider your priorities and the space you have.
